進行調(diào)試。linux下gdb如何調(diào)試python程序 (1)假設(shè)要debug的進程號為1000,運行如下命令:gdb -p 1000 使用此命令即可使gdb附加到進程。

成都創(chuàng)新互聯(lián)公司一直通過網(wǎng)站建設(shè)和網(wǎng)站營銷幫助企業(yè)獲得更多客戶資源。 以"深度挖掘,量身打造,注重實效"的一站式服務(wù),以網(wǎng)站設(shè)計制作、成都做網(wǎng)站、移動互聯(lián)產(chǎn)品、全網(wǎng)整合營銷推廣服務(wù)為核心業(yè)務(wù)。十余年網(wǎng)站制作的經(jīng)驗,使用新網(wǎng)站建設(shè)技術(shù),全新開發(fā)出的標(biāo)準(zhǔn)網(wǎng)站,不但價格便宜而且實用、靈活,特別適合中小公司網(wǎng)站制作。網(wǎng)站管理系統(tǒng)簡單易用,維護方便,您可以完全操作網(wǎng)站資料,是中小公司快速網(wǎng)站建設(shè)的選擇。
gdb是用來調(diào)試二進制程序的,不能調(diào)試python腳本。python自帶pdb模塊,可以用來調(diào)試自己的腳本。使用python -m pdb 腳本.py,交互方式,命令與gdb類似。
安裝gdb方式,sudo apt-get install gdb ,有ok點擊ok安裝,直到安裝結(jié)束。gcc -g aa.c之后才能調(diào)試a.out文件。
首先下載安裝python,建議安裝7版本以上,0版本以下,由于0版本以上不向下兼容,體驗較差。打開文本編輯器,推薦editplus,notepad等,將文件保存成 .py格式,editplus和notepad支持識別python語法。
直接使用python xxxx.py執(zhí)行。其中python可以寫成python的絕對路徑。使用which python進行查詢。
[Linux]gdb查看內(nèi)存區(qū)命令 用gdb查看內(nèi)存 格式: x /nfu 說明 x 是 examine 的縮寫 n表示要顯示的內(nèi)存單元的個數(shù) f表示顯示方式, 可取如下值 x 按十六進制格式顯示變量。d 按十進制格式顯示變量。
在 gdb 中,運行程序使用 r 或是 run 命令。程序的運行,你有可能需要設(shè)置下面四方面的事。1 、程序運行參數(shù)。set args 可指定運行時參數(shù)。
Linux調(diào)試程序大多數(shù)都是喜歡用gdb,gdb是一個命令行界面的程序調(diào)試工具,任何調(diào)試操作都是輸入命令來實現(xiàn)的。
1 pwd命令 該命令的英文解釋為print working directory(打印工作目錄)。輸入pwd命令,Linux會輸出當(dāng)前目錄。2 cd命令 cd命令用來改變所在目錄。
在Linux系統(tǒng)中,啟動項目時出現(xiàn)completestacktrace錯誤可能是由于以下幾個原因: 項目依賴庫不完整或版本不匹配,導(dǎo)致項目無法啟動。 項目配置文件存在問題,比如配置文件中指定了錯誤的端口或路徑。
head:顯示文件的開頭的內(nèi)容。在默認情況下,head命令顯示文件的頭10行內(nèi)容;tail:查看文件尾部內(nèi)容,有一個常用的參數(shù)-f常用于查閱正在改變的文件。
1、在60版Linux內(nèi)核及以后,GDB對使用fork/vfork創(chuàng)建子進程的程序提供了follow-fork-mode選項來支持多進程調(diào)試。
2、gdb python pid 進行調(diào)試。linux下gdb如何調(diào)試python程序 (1)假設(shè)要debug的進程號為1000,運行如下命令:gdb -p 1000 使用此命令即可使gdb附加到進程。
3、gdb是用來調(diào)試二進制程序的,不能調(diào)試python腳本。 python自帶pdb模塊,可以用來調(diào)試自己的腳本。 使用python -m pdb ,交互方式,命令與gdb類似。
4、安裝gdb方式,sudo apt-get install gdb ,有ok點擊ok安裝,直到安裝結(jié)束。gcc -g aa.c之后才能調(diào)試a.out文件。
網(wǎng)頁名稱:linux的gdb命令 linux gdb命令
網(wǎng)址分享:http://chinadenli.net/article5/deodgoi.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供網(wǎng)頁設(shè)計公司、電子商務(wù)、網(wǎng)站制作、域名注冊、手機網(wǎng)站建設(shè)、搜索引擎優(yōu)化
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)